ORDER LIFTING STAY
This matter is before the Court on the October 11, 2011 Order of Court of the
Supreme Court for the State of Colorado, filed as Docket No. 44. The Colorado
Supreme Court has declined to answer this Court’s Order Certifying Question to the
Colorado Supreme Court [Docket No. 39]. As a result, there is no longer any good
cause to stay proceedings in this case.
Accordingly, it is
ORDERED that the Order granting the Joint Motion to Stay Proceedings Pending
Certification of Question to the Colorado Supreme Court and Request to Propose
Questions to be Certified to the Colorado Supreme Court [Docket No. 32] is VACATED.
It is further
ORDERED that the parties shall file status reports on or before November 8,
2011 regarding what deadlines should be set in this matter.
